An MTK Unlock Offline Tool is a software utility designed for Windows, Linux, or macOS that operates directly with MediaTek System-on-Chips (SoCs). Unlike online services, these tools function without an internet connection, directly exploiting BROM (Boot ROM) mode on the device to perform tasks.

Installing the MTK Universal Offline Tool requires setting up the proper environment on a Windows PC (compatible with Windows 7 through 11) to ensure the computer can communicate with the phone in "Brom" or "Preloader" mode.
